Jason,

>From my point of view wl_drm isn't link to Mesa, it is only about
exchange buffers by using a file descriptor and, for example, doesn't
rely on EGL.

I understand that other graphic stacks could have defined their own
way to for zero-copy (and so other protocols).
I don't aim to make gstreamer wayland sink works for all of them but
at least with wl_drm protocol which is quite generic.

Since dmabuf has been adopted in kernel we have the opportunity to
rationalize also some code in userland and for that we need a common
wayland protocol.
Move wl_drm into wayland-core make it more easily accessible for all
software even for those who don't use Mesa.

>> > I'm working for Linaro on enabling a zero copy path in GStreamer by
>> > using dmabuf.
>> > To make this possible I have patched gst wayland sink to use wayland
>> > drm protocol: https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=711155
>> >
>> > Today wayland drm protocol is limited to Mesa so I have decided to
>> > move it into wayland-core.
>> > My hardware doesn't have gpu support yet so I have patched weston
>> > (pixman) to allow usage of wl_drm buffers.
>> > With this I able to share/use a buffer allocated by DRM in gstreamer
>> > pipeline even if I don't have gpu and EGL.
>> >
>> > What do you think about make wayland drm protocol available like this ?

>> The problem here is that wl_drm is really a mesa extension.  Well, more of
>> an open-source linux graphics stack extension.  The point is that there are
>> other graphics stacks: Rhaspberry Pi, libhybris, other proprietary stacks,
>> etc.  and each of these graphics stacks has its own extension for passing
>> hardware buffers around.  This means that if you want your GStreamer sink to
>> work on these other stacks with zero-copy, you will have to talk their
>> protocols.  Because wl_drm isn't global to all of wayland, it probably
>> shouldn't go into the wayland core.
>>
>> This does not mean, however, that wl_drm can't be exposed in a more
>> sensible way.  As of 1.3, we are now exporting wayland.xml to
>> /usr/share/wayland and we can put other extensions there as well.  We could
>> have, for instance, a /usr/share/mesa.xml file that provides the mesa
>> extensions.  Then projects wanting to talk directly to mesa can generate the
>> header and C files from the system-installed xml file.  This would solve the
>> problem of keeping everything in sync.
>>
>> One last note (this one's been bugging me for a while).  If we are going
>> to export wl_drm in some way, we should probably rename it to something like
>> mesa_drm.  We really need to get out of the habit of using the wl_ namespace
>> for everything that talks the wayland protocol.  If we don't alter the
>> details of wl_drm in the rename, it shouldn't be too hard to move everyone
>> over from wl_drm to mesa_drm.

+  <!-- drm support. This object is created by the server and published
+       using the display's global event. -->
+  <interface name="wl_drm" version="2">
+    <enum name="error">
+      <entry name="authenticate_fail" value="0"/>
+      <entry name="invalid_format" value="1"/>
+      <entry name="invalid_name" value="2"/>
+    </enum>
+
+    <enum name="format">
+      <!-- The drm format codes match the #defines in drm_fourcc.h.
+           The formats actually supported by the compositor will be
+           reported by the format event. -->
+      <entry name="c8" value="0x20203843"/>
+      <entry name="rgb332" value="0x38424752"/>
+      <entry name="bgr233" value="0x38524742"/>
+      <entry name="xrgb4444" value="0x32315258"/>
+      <entry name="xbgr4444" value="0x32314258"/>
+      <entry name="rgbx4444" value="0x32315852"/>
+      <entry name="bgrx4444" value="0x32315842"/>
+      <entry name="argb4444" value="0x32315241"/>
+      <entry name="abgr4444" value="0x32314241"/>
+      <entry name="rgba4444" value="0x32314152"/>
+      <entry name="bgra4444" value="0x32314142"/>
+      <entry name="xrgb1555" value="0x35315258"/>
+      <entry name="xbgr1555" value="0x35314258"/>
+      <entry name="rgbx5551" value="0x35315852"/>
+      <entry name="bgrx5551" value="0x35315842"/>
+      <entry name="argb1555" value="0x35315241"/>
+      <entry name="abgr1555" value="0x35314241"/>
+      <entry name="rgba5551" value="0x35314152"/>
+      <entry name="bgra5551" value="0x35314142"/>
+      <entry name="rgb565" value="0x36314752"/>
+      <entry name="bgr565" value="0x36314742"/>
+      <entry name="rgb888" value="0x34324752"/>
+      <entry name="bgr888" value="0x34324742"/>
+      <entry name="xrgb8888" value="0x34325258"/>
+      <entry name="xbgr8888" value="0x34324258"/>
+      <entry name="rgbx8888" value="0x34325852"/>
+      <entry name="bgrx8888" value="0x34325842"/>
+      <entry name="argb8888" value="0x34325241"/>
+      <entry name="abgr8888" value="0x34324241"/>
+      <entry name="rgba8888" value="0x34324152"/>
+      <entry name="bgra8888" value="0x34324142"/>
+      <entry name="xrgb2101010" value="0x30335258"/>
+      <entry name="xbgr2101010" value="0x30334258"/>
+      <entry name="rgbx1010102" value="0x30335852"/>
+      <entry name="bgrx1010102" value="0x30335842"/>
+      <entry name="argb2101010" value="0x30335241"/>
+      <entry name="abgr2101010" value="0x30334241"/>
+      <entry name="rgba1010102" value="0x30334152"/>
+      <entry name="bgra1010102" value="0x30334142"/>
+      <entry name="yuyv" value="0x56595559"/>
+      <entry name="yvyu" value="0x55595659"/>
+      <entry name="uyvy" value="0x59565955"/>
+      <entry name="vyuy" value="0x59555956"/>
+      <entry name="ayuv" value="0x56555941"/>
+      <entry name="nv12" value="0x3231564e"/>
+      <entry name="nv21" value="0x3132564e"/>
+      <entry name="nv16" value="0x3631564e"/>
+      <entry name="nv61" value="0x3136564e"/>
+      <entry name="yuv410" value="0x39565559"/>
+      <entry name="yvu410" value="0x39555659"/>
+      <entry name="yuv411" value="0x31315559"/>
+      <entry name="yvu411" value="0x31315659"/>
+      <entry name="yuv420" value="0x32315559"/>
+      <entry name="yvu420" value="0x32315659"/>
+      <entry name="yuv422" value="0x36315559"/>
+      <entry name="yvu422" value="0x36315659"/>
+      <entry name="yuv444" value="0x34325559"/>
+      <entry name="yvu444" value="0x34325659"/>
+    </enum>
+
+    <!-- Call this request with the magic received from drmGetMagic().
+         It will be passed on to the drmAuthMagic() or
+         DRIAuthConnection() call.  This authentication must be
+         completed before create_buffer could be used. -->
+    <request name="authenticate">
+      <arg name="id" type="uint"/>
+    </request>
+
+    <!-- Create a wayland buffer for the named DRM buffer.  The DRM
+         surface must have a name using the flink ioctl -->
+    <request name="create_buffer">
+      <arg name="id" type="new_id" interface="wl_buffer"/>
+      <arg name="name" type="uint"/>
+      <arg name="width"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="height"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="stride" type="uint"/>
+      <arg name="format" type="uint"/>
+    </request>
+
+    <!-- Create a wayland buffer for the named DRM buffer.  The DRM
+         surface must have a name using the flink ioctl -->
+    <request name="create_planar_buffer">
+      <arg name="id" type="new_id" interface="wl_buffer"/>
+      <arg name="name" type="uint"/>
+      <arg name="width"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="height"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="format" type="uint"/>
+      <arg name="offset0"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="stride0"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="offset1"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="stride1"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="offset2"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="stride2" type="int"/>
+    </request>
+
+    <!-- Create a wayland buffer for the prime fd.  Use for regular and planar
+         buffers.  Pass 0 for offset and stride for unused planes. -->
+    <request name="create_prime_buffer" since="2">
+      <arg name="id" type="new_id" interface="wl_buffer"/>
+      <arg name="name" type="fd"/>
+      <arg name="width"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="height"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="format" type="uint"/>
+      <arg name="offset0"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="stride0"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="offset1"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="stride1"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="offset2" type="int"/>
+      <arg name="stride2" type="int"/>
+    </request>
+
+    <!-- Notification of the path of the drm device which is used by
+         the server.  The client should use this device for creating
+         local buffers.  Only buffers created from this device should
+         be be passed to the server using this drm object's
+         create_buffer request. -->
+    <event name="device">
+      <arg name="name" type="string"/>
+    </event>
+
+    <event name="format">
+      <arg name="format" type="uint"/>
+    </event>
+
+    <!-- Raised if the authenticate request succeeded -->
+    <event name="authenticated"/>
+
+    <enum name="capability" since="2">
+      <description summary="wl_drm capability bitmask">
+        Bitmask of capabilities.
+      </description>
+      <entry name="prime" value="1" summary="wl_drm prime available"/>
+    </enum>
+
+    <event name="capabilities">
+      <arg name="value" type="uint"/>
+    </event>
+  </interface>
+
+</protocol>

+struct wl_drm {
+	struct wl_display *display;
+	struct wl_global *wl_drm_global;
+
+	void *user_data;
+	char *device_name;
+	uint32_t flags;
+
+	struct wayland_drm_callbacks *callbacks;
+
+	struct wl_buffer_interface buffer_interface;
+};
+
+static void
+destroy_buffer(struct wl_resource *resource)
+{
+	struct wl_drm_buffer *buffer = resource->data;
+	struct wl_drm *drm = buffer->drm;
+
+	drm->callbacks->release_buffer(drm->user_data, buffer);
+	free(buffer);
+}
+
+static void
+buffer_destroy(struct wl_client *client, struct wl_resource *resource)
+{
+	wl_resource_destroy(resource);
+}
+
+static void
+create_buffer(struct wl_client *client, struct wl_resource *resource,
+              uint32_t id, uint32_t name, int fd,
+              int32_t width, int32_t height,
+              uint32_t format,
+              int32_t offset0, int32_t stride0,
+              int32_t offset1, int32_t stride1,
+              int32_t offset2, int32_t stride2)
+{
+	struct wl_drm *drm = resource->data;
+	struct wl_drm_buffer *buffer;
+
+	buffer = calloc(1, sizeof *buffer);
+	if (buffer == NULL) {
+		wl_resource_post_no_memory(resource);
+		return;
+	}
+
+	buffer->drm = drm;
+	buffer->width = width;
+	buffer->height = height;
+	buffer->format = format;
+	buffer->offset[0] = offset0;
+	buffer->stride[0] = stride0;
+	buffer->offset[1] = offset1;
+	buffer->stride[1] = stride1;
+	buffer->offset[2] = offset2;
+	buffer->stride[2] = stride2;
+
+	drm->callbacks->reference_buffer(drm->user_data, name, fd, buffer);
+	if (buffer->driver_buffer == NULL) {
+		wl_resource_post_error(resource,
+				       WL_DRM_ERROR_INVALID_NAME,
+				       "invalid name");
+		return;
+	}
+
+	buffer->resource =
+		wl_resource_create(client, &wl_buffer_interface, 1, id);
+	if (!buffer->resource) {
+		wl_resource_post_no_memory(resource);
+		free(buffer);
+		return;
+	}
+
+	wl_resource_set_implementation(buffer->resource,
+				       (void (**)(void)) &drm->buffer_interface,
+				       buffer, destroy_buffer);
+}
+
+static void
+drm_create_buffer(struct wl_client *client, struct wl_resource *resource,
+		  uint32_t id, uint32_t name, int32_t width, int32_t height,
+		  uint32_t stride, uint32_t format)
+{
+    switch (format) {
+		case WL_DRM_FORMAT_ARGB8888:
+        case WL_DRM_FORMAT_XRGB8888:
+        case W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UYV:
+        case WL_DRM_FORMAT_RGB565:
+			break;
+        default:
+                wl_resource_post_error(resource,
+                                       WL_DRM_ERROR_INVALID_FORMAT,
+                                       "invalid format");
+			return;
+    }
+
+    create_buffer(client, resource, id,
+		name, -1, width, height, format, 0, stride, 0, 0, 0, 0);
+}
+
+static void
+drm_create_planar_buffer(struct wl_client *client,
+                         struct wl_resource *resource,
+                         uint32_t id, uint32_t name,
+                         int32_t width, int32_t height, uint32_t format,
+                         int32_t offset0, int32_t stride0,
+                         int32_t offset1, int32_t stride1,
+                         int32_t offset2, int32_t stride2)
+{
+    switch (format) {
+		case W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UV410:
+		case W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UV411:
+		case W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UV420:
+		case W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UV422:
+		case W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UV444:
+		case WL_DRM_FORMAT_NV12:
+		case WL_DRM_FORMAT_NV16:
+			break;
+        default:
+                wl_resource_post_error(resource,
+                                       WL_DRM_ERROR_INVALID_FORMAT,
+                                       "invalid format");
+			return;
+    }
+
+    create_buffer(client, resource, id, name, -1, width, height, format,
+		offset0, stride0, offset1, stride1, offset2, stride2);
+}
+
+static void
+drm_create_prime_buffer(struct wl_client *client,
+                        struct wl_resource *resource,
+                        uint32_t id, int fd,
+                        int32_t width, int32_t height, uint32_t format,
+                        int32_t offset0, int32_t stride0,
+                        int32_t offset1, int32_t stride1,
+                        int32_t offset2, int32_t stride2)
+{
+    create_buffer(client, resource, id, 0, fd, width, height, format,
+                      offset0, stride0, offset1, stride1, offset2, stride2);
+    close(fd);
+}
+
+static void
+drm_authenticate(struct wl_client *client,
+		 struct wl_resource *resource, uint32_t id)
+{
+	struct wl_drm *drm = resource->data;
+
+	if (drm->callbacks->authenticate(drm->user_data, id) < 0)
+		wl_resource_post_error(resource,
+				       WL_DRM_ERROR_AUTHENTICATE_FAIL,
+				       "authenicate failed");
+	else
+		w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_AUTHENTICATED);
+}
+
+static const struct wl_drm_interface drm_interface = {
+	drm_authenticate,
+	drm_create_buffer,
+    drm_create_planar_buffer,
+    drm_create_prime_buffer
+};
+
+static void
+bind_drm(struct wl_client *client, void *data, uint32_t version, uint32_t id)
+{
+	struct wl_drm *drm = data;
+	struct wl_resource *resource;
+	uint32_t capabilities;
+
+	resource = wl_resource_create(client, &wl_drm_interface,
+				      MIN(version, 2), id);
+	if (!resource) {
+		wl_client_post_no_memory(client);
+		return;
+	}
+
+	wl_resource_set_implementation(resource, &drm_interface, data, NULL);
+
+	w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_DEVICE, drm->device_name);
+	w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T,
+			       WL_DRM_FORMAT_ARGB8888);
+	w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T,
+			       WL_DRM_FORMAT_XRGB8888);
+	w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T,
+                               WL_DRM_FORMAT_RGB565);
+    w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T, W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UV410);
+    w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T, W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UV411);
+    w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T, W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UV420);
+    w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T, W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UV422);
+    w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T, W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UV444);
+    w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T, WL_DRM_FORMAT_NV12);
+    w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T, WL_DRM_FORMAT_NV16);
+    w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_FORMAT, WL_DRM_FORMAT_YUYV);
+
+    capabilities = 0;
+    if (drm->flags & WAYLAND_DRM_PRIME)
+        capabilities |= WL_DRM_CAPABILITY_PRIME;
+
+    if (version >= 2)
+        wl_resource_post_event(resource, WL_DRM_CAPABILITIES, capabilities);
+}
+
+struct wl_drm_buffer *
+wayland_drm_buffer_get(struct wl_drm *drm, struct wl_resource *resource)
+{
+	if (resource == NULL)
+		return NULL;
+
+    if (wl_resource_instance_of(resource, &wl_buffer_interface,
+                                    &drm->buffer_interface))
+		return wl_resource_get_user_data(resource);
+    else
+		return NULL;
+}
+
+WL_EXPORT struct wl_drm *
+wayland_drm_init(struct wl_display *display, char *device_name,
+                 struct wayland_drm_callbacks *callbacks, void *user_data,
+                 uint32_t flags)
+{
+	struct wl_drm *drm;
+
+	drm = malloc(sizeof *drm);
+
+	drm->display = display;
+	drm->device_name = strdup(device_name);
+	drm->callbacks = callbacks;
+	drm->user_data = user_data;
+    drm->flags = flags;
+
+    drm->buffer_interface.destroy = buffer_destroy;
+
+	drm->wl_drm_global =
+		wl_global_create(display, &wl_drm_interface, 2,
+				 drm, bind_drm);
+
+	return drm;
+}
+
+WL_EXPORT void
+wayland_drm_uninit(struct wl_drm *drm)
+{
+	free(drm->device_name);
+
+	wl_global_destroy(drm->wl_drm_global);
+
+	free(drm);
+}
+
+WL_EXPORT int
+wayland_buffer_is_drm(struct wl_drm_buffer *buffer)
+{
+	struct wl_drm *drm = buffer->drm;
+
+	return wl_resource_instance_of(buffer->resource,
+			&wl_buffer_interface, &drm->buffer_interface);
+}
+
+WL_EXPORT uint32_t
+wayland_drm_buffer_get_format(struct wl_drm_buffer *buffer)
+{
+	if (!wayland_buffer_is_drm(buffer))
+		return 0;
+
+	return buffer->format;
+}
+
+WL_EXPORT void *
+wayland_drm_buffer_get_buffer(struct wl_drm_buffer *buffer)
+{
+	return buffer->driver_buffer;
+}
+
+WL_EXPORT int32_t
+wayland_drm_buffer_get_stride(struct wl_drm_buffer *buffer, int idx)
+{
+	if (!wayland_buffer_is_drm(buffer))
+		return 0;
+
+	return buffer->stride[idx];
+}
+
+WL_EXPORT void *
+wayland_drm_buffer_get_data(struct wl_drm_buffer *buffer)
+{
+	struct wl_drm *drm;
+
+	if (!wayland_buffer_is_drm(buffer))
+		return NULL;
+
+	drm = buffer->drm;
+
+	if (drm->callbacks->get_data)
+		return drm->callbacks->get_data(drm->user_data, buffer);
+
+	return NULL;
+}
+
+WL_EXPORT void
+wayland_drm_buffer_put_data(struct wl_drm_buffer *buffer)
+{
+	struct wl_drm *drm;
+
+	if (!wayland_buffer_is_drm(buffer))
+		return;
+
+	drm = buffer->drm;
+
+	if (drm->callbacks->put_data)
+		drm->callbacks->put_data(drm->user_data, buffer);
+
+	return;
+}
+
+
+WL_EXPORT int32_t
+wayland_drm_buffer_get_width(struct wl_drm_buffer *buffer)
+{
+	if (!wayland_buffer_is_drm(buffer))
+		return 0;
+
+	return buffer->width;
+}
+
+WL_EXPORT int32_t
+wayland_drm_buffer_get_height(struct wl_drm_buffer *buffer)
+{
+	if (!wayland_buffer_is_drm(buffer))
+		return 0;
+
+	return buffer->height;
+}
